Q&A

  • [답변] FieldByName과 ParamByName의 차이점
Query1.Sql.Add('Select AA from Atable where BB = :bb');
Query1.ParamByName('bb').AsString := sname;
위는 SQL문안 bb라는 파라미터에 값을 넘겨주는것이구요!!

str_AA := Query1.FieldByName('AA').AsString;
str_AA라는 변수에 DB에서 AA컬럼에 값을 가져오는것입니다.
도움이 되었으면 좋겠습니다. ^_^..
1  COMMENTS
  • Profile
    KDDG_ZZOM 2002.05.13 23:44
    ParamByName은 말그대로 쿼리문 실행시 필요한 값을 넘겨주는거고
    FieldByName은 받을때 사용하는것 같네요...